Aluminium rivet with steel stem and all aluminium sleeve
The Avdel Avdelmate® rivet is a two-piece wide-grip, breakstem fastener suitable for a range of applications in soft, thin sheet and brittle materials. The Avdelmate fastener brand is a new extension to the Avdel rivet portfolio that provides a targeted solution in certain niche market applications. Avdelmate fasteners provide a secure clamp without crushing the parent material and good hole fill due to the radially expanded rivet body. This makes the Avdelmate fastener ideal for stadium seating, furniture, playground equipment and racking applications.
Key features and benefits
Extra-wide grip range from 15.8 mm to 98.4 mm
Large bearing area against both sides of the application spreads the tail bearing load/clamp load on the rear sheet to prevent damage
Clamps tightly and securely without crushing parent material
Excellent hole fill via radially expanded rivet body for a strong and vibration resistant joint
Rivet stem retained in tubular component avoids loose stems
Low profile headform on both sides of the application for a neat appearance Ideal for use in thin sheet, soft, brittle or low strength materials,
Avdelmate® can be used to fasten:
Metal to metal
Plastic to plastic
Metal to plastic
Metal rear sheet
Various composite materials
